Ultrastructural characterization of RPA-containing domains in nuclei assembled in Xenopus egg extracts
Authors:Eltsov M  Grandi P  Raska I
Institution:Department of Cell Biology, Institute of Experimental Medicine, Academy of Sciences of the Czech Republic, Prague 2, Albertov 4, CZ-128 00, Czech Republic.
Abstract:We describe novel structural domains in in vitro reconstituted Xenopus sperm nuclei, which we term RPA bodies; RPA is the only known marker of these structures. These bodies contain DNA and represent special chromatin domains as seen by transmission electron microscopy. We show that RPA bodies exhibit a similar ultrastructure in nuclei assembled in high-speed supernatant (HSS) of Xenopus egg extract and in nuclei assembled in HSS supplemented with low-speed supernatant (HSS + LSS nuclei). Moreover, RPA bodies are also formed when sperm chromatin containing double-stranded DNA breaks is incubated with HSS of egg extracts. RPA bodies appear to be compartmentalized. By immunoelectron microscopy we show that RPA is preferentially localized at the periphery of the bodies where DNA synthesis also occurs in HSS + LSS nuclei.
